Experiments with Haptic Perception in a Robotic Hand
Magnus Johnsson, Robert Pallbo, Christian Balkenius

Abstract
This paper describes a robotic hand, LUCS Haptic Hand I, that has been built as a first step in a project aiming at the study haptic perception. Grasping tests with the hand were done with different objects, and the signal patterns from the sensors were studied and an-alyzed. The results suggest that LUCS Haptic Hand I provides signal patterns that are possible to categorize. Certain higher-level properties were found that can be derived from the raw data that can be used as a basis for haptic object categorization. 1
